[MODERN APPROACHES TO THE SURGICAL TREATMENT FOR EARLY-STAGE ENDOMETRIAL CANCER]

Vopr Onkol. 2015;61(3):346-51.
[Article in Russian]

Abstract

The article is devoted to one of the most controversial issues of modern oncogynecology--the volume of surgery for endometrial cancer of early stages. There are discussed the indications for lymphadenectomy and its volume as well as how correlate performing lymphadenectomy and conducting postoperative radiotherapy.
